JV1.1. (30) The height of my tv screen is 3/4 its width. If the diagonal is 30 inches, what is the width in inches?

JV1.2. (20) 8 teams play in a tournament in which teams are eliminated only after losing two games. What is the largest number of games that could be played?

JV1.3. (30) My stock increased in value 20% the first year and 30% the second. What is the total percentage increase?

JV1.5. (30) My final grade is the average of 3 midterms plus the final, with the final being given twice the weight of each of the other 3 exams. I scored 88, 86, and 92 on the three midterms. What do I need to score on the final so my average is 90?

JV1.6 (30) If I flip a fair coin three times, what is the probability of getting at least one head?

JV1.7 (30)The product of three consecutive odd integers is 315. What is the smallest of the three integers?

JV1.8 (30) What is the greatest common divisor of 108 and 360?

JV1.12 (30) The volume of a pyramid with a square base and a height of 5 inches is 15 cubic inches. What is the length in inches of the side of the base?

JV2.1 (30) How many hours is it from 3 am Sunday to 7 p.m Friday?

JV2.2 (30) One faucet can fill a tub in 20 minutes, another in 30 minutes. How long will it take to fill if both faucets are used?

JV2.4 (30) The first term of a sequence is 1. Thereafter, each term is the sum of all preceding terms. What is the 8-th term?

JV2.5 (30) What will this computer program print?

x = 2

while x < 100

x = x+3

end while

print x

JV2.7 (30) Express the infinite decimal .363636... as a reduced fraction.

JV2.9 (20) By what factor is the volume of a cylinder increased if its height is doubled and its diameter is tripled?

JV2.10 (30) The squares of two consecutive positive odd integers differ by 48. What is their sum?

JV2.11 (30) An equilateral triangle of side is inscribed in a circle. What is the circle's radius?

JV2.12 (20) If I roll two dice, what is the probability the product of the numbers is even?

JV3.1 (30) If you correctly fill out a 9 by 9 Sudoku puzzle, what is the sum of all the numbers?

JV3.2 (30) A swimming pool is 20 feet wide, 30 feet long, and 8 feet deep. How many hours will it take to fill it with a hose with capacity 1/2 cubic foot per minute?

V3.4 (20) If I roll three dice what is the probability the sum of the three numbers is even?

JV3.5 (30) Give the average of the set of odd numbers which are between 4 and 22.

JV3.6 (30) Two positive numbers differ by 4; their squares differ by 36. What is their sum?

JV3.12 (20) What is the interior angle, in degrees, of a regular dodecagon?

JV4.1 (30) Four lines can divide the plane into how many regions at most?

JV4.2. (30) Four consecutive even integers add up to 284. What is the smallest of the four?

JV4.3 (20) We break a decagon into triangles by joining vertices. How many triangles do we get?

JV4.4 (30) How many different ways are there to arrange the letters {a, b, c, d} so that b is immediately to the right of a?

JV4.5 (30) If the two digits of a number are reversed the number is increased by 18. What is the largest number it could be?

JV4.6 (30) A swimming pool is circular in shape. I swim from one side 10 feet and touch the wall. I turn 90 degrees and swim 24 feet again touching the wall. What is the diameter of the pool?

JV4.7 (20) What is the total surface area of a hemisphere of radius 2?

JV4.8 (45) How many ways can I make a total of 50 cents if I have only quarters, dimes and nickels?

JV4.9 (45) A cone has radius 3 inches and height 4 inches. What is the area of the slanted part?

JV4.11 (30) What is the proba-bility I draw two socks of the same color if I draw randomly from a drawer with 4 grey socks and 3 black socks?
